Williston, N.D. (AP)  The suspect in the fatal shooting of another man outside a Williston bar over the weekend has been apprehended in Billings, Mont.
 
Authorities say the Montana Highway Patrol arrested 46-year-old Jonathan Peter Horvath Monday afternoon.
 
Rod Ostermiller, the U.S. Marshal's Service Chief Deputy for Montana said that Horvath was taken into custody after being spotted in a field west of Billings.
 
Authorities say 28-year-old Derrick Siegel, of Williston, died at a hospital after the shooting about 1 A.M. Saturday. Williston police detective cory collings said that horvath was wanted on warrants for reckless endangerment and murder.
 
Collings says Horvath recently moved to the Williston area from Sandpoint, Idaho.
